I initially got Firefox because my computer (which I shared at the time) was being flooded with spyware that affected IE. Soon after, I enjoyed the tabbed browsing aspect of it. It doesn't seem like anything special now, considering I don't use many extensions. However, when going back to IE, I find that there are so many little habits I have that I suddenly can't browse without, Like typing "wp (article)" to go to Wikipedia, or middle-clicking for a new tab.

That's why I'm a proud Firefox junkie! :D
